Carpet disposal services involve the professional removal and responsible disposal of old, worn, or damaged carpets from residential or commercial properties. This process typically includes the careful extraction of the carpet, padding, and any leftover adhesives or materials, ensuring the space is cleared efficiently and cleanly. Service providers often handle the disassembly, haul-away, and proper disposal of the materials, saving property owners the hassle of dealing with bulky, heavy flooring debris. These services are especially useful during renovations, remodels, or when replacing outdated carpets with newer flooring options.

Many property owners turn to carpet disposal services to address common problems such as accumulated dirt, stains, or odors that cannot be effectively removed through cleaning. Over time, carpets can become frayed or damaged, making them unsightly or unsafe. Removing old carpets also helps improve indoor air quality by eliminating allergens, dust mites, and mold that may be embedded in the fibers. These services help create a cleaner, healthier living or working environment by ensuring that old, unusable carpets are properly taken out and disposed of in accordance with local regulations.

The overview below groups typical Carpet Disposal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Huntsville, AL.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Carpet Disposal Jobs - Typically, local contractors charge between $250 and $600 for small-scale carpet removal projects, such as single rooms or small sections.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, making it a common cost for straightforward disposal needs.

Moderate Carpet Removal - For larger areas or multiple rooms, costs generally range from $600 to $1,200. Projects of this size are more frequent and may include additional services like padding removal or debris cleanup.

Full Carpet Replacement - When replacing entire carpets in a home or commercial space, expenses can range from $1,200 to $3,500 or more, depending on the size and complexity. Larger, more intricate projects can reach beyond this range but are less common.

Specialized or Complex Jobs - Larger, more complex projects such as commercial spaces or difficult-to-access areas can cost $3,500 and up, with some jobs exceeding $5,000. These are less frequent and typically involve extensive labor or specialized equipment.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
